About the Role
As an SEN Teacher, you will play a key role in supporting the academic and social development of children with varying abilities. The successful candidate will be responsible for creating an engaging and adaptive curriculum, implementing effective teaching strategies, and supporting students in reaching their full potential. You will work within a collaborative team to ensure the students receive the best possible care, education, and emotional support.

Key Responsibilities

  1. Lesson Planning & Curriculum Development

    • Develop engaging, inclusive, and well-structured lesson plans that align with the school s curriculum and meet the diverse needs of the students.

    • Use creative and varied instructional strategies to engage students, including hands-on activities, group projects, and multimedia resources.

  2. Delivering Lessons

    • Teach in a clear and effective manner, ensuring all students understand and engage with the material.

    • Adapt your teaching style and resources to meet the needs of each student, including those with autism, ADHD, learning disabilities, and other special needs.

  3. Assessing and Monitoring Progress

    • Conduct regular assessments to monitor student's progress and adjust teaching methods as needed to support individual learning goals.

    • Provide constructive and actionable feedback to students and their families, helping them achieve their full potential.

  4. Classroom Management & Support

    • Foster a positive, respectful classroom environment by implementing strategies to manage behaviour and encourage active participation.

    • Work closely with teaching assistants to provide one-on-one or small group support as needed.

    • Assist in managing challenging behaviours using positive reinforcement and a calm, patient approach.

  5. Supporting Social and Emotional Development

    • Build strong, trusting relationships with students to understand their emotional and social needs, helping them develop essential life skills.

    • Provide guidance and support to students, helping them navigate challenges both in and outside of the classroom.

  6. Collaboration with Staff and Families

    • Collaborate with fellow teachers, special education professionals, and support staff to ensure the student's academic and emotional needs are met.

    • Maintain strong communication with parents and guardians, regularly updating them on their child s progress and working together to address any concerns.

  7. Personal Care & Inclusion

    • Where necessary, provide personal care and assist students with mobility or physical needs, always maintaining dignity and respect.

    • Promote inclusivity in the classroom, ensuring that every student feels valued and supported.
